Specifications
Current - Output High, Low: 32mA, 32mA
Base Part Number: 74LVC1G14
Package / Case: 5-XFBGA, DSBGA
Supplier Device Package: 5-DSBGA, 5-WCSP (1.4x0.9)
Mounting Type: Surface Mount
Operating Temperature: -40°C ~ 85°C
Max Propagation Delay @ V, Max CL: 5ns @ 5V, 50pF
Logic Level - High: 1.16 V ~ 3.33 V
Logic Level - Low: 0.39 V ~ 1.87 V
Series: 74LVC
Current - Quiescent (Max): 10µA
Voltage - Supply: 1.65 V ~ 5.5 V
Features: Schmitt Trigger
Number of Inputs: 1
Number of Circuits: 1
Logic Type: Inverter
Part Status: Obsolete
Packaging: Tape & Reel (TR)
